Prospectives ’12 International Festival of Digital Art highlights the 
work of graduate and Phd candidates working across all disciplines 
utilizing experimental digital media in their creative endeavors.

Prospectives ‘12, the third iteration of our festival, breaks down into 
six interrelated events/venues:
•Exhibit (A one month group exhibition at the Sheppard Fine Arts 
Gallery, UNR)
•Netart (discrete internet based artworks highlighted through the 
festival website and accessible at the exhibit venue)
•Perform (A one night event of performances and screenings at The Nevada 
Museum of Art, Wayne and Miriam Prim Theater)
• Project/sound (An evening of projected, full-dome and standard 
formatted video and performances/playback of electro-acoustic and sound 
works at The Fleischman Planetarium, UNR - mono, stereo, and 5.1 
surround sound capabilities )
•Present (A day long symposium of poster sessions and paper presentations)
•Street (Temporary, street level works situated in and around Reno)

Eligibility: If you are enrolled or were enrolled in a graduate or Phd 
program in 2012, working creatively in and across disciplines focused on 
digital technologies in your creative practice, you are eligible and 
encouraged to submit an application!

Creative practitioners working in all visual and performative media 
incorporating digital systems, including but not limited to: interactive 
art, robotics, movement/dance, computer gaming, net art, 
culture-jamming, full-dome video/animation, generative systems, social 
practice, electronic sculpture, locative media, augmented reality, 
electronic music/audio art, experimental theater, performance art, 
telematics, electro-acoustics, sound art, etc. are invited to apply. 
Collaborations and works-in-progress are welcome and encouraged.
